Watching from the windows of their zebra-striped all-terrain bus a group of happy children arrives at the wildlife park. Theyre joining in the catchy refrain that the wheels on the bus go round & round encouraging readers to do exactly the same! As the bus drives the children all around the park its the animals who take centre-stage allowing this much-loved rhyme to enter new territory steered by Jan Ormerods fresh & lively interpretation of the song. So with the established rhythm of the song put in motion by the bus children can join in as the antelopes spring so high in the air the otters in the pool float paw in paw & the llamas in the field go trot trot trot. & of course there are actions inspired by the animals antics too. Lindsey Gardiner has created colourful collage illustrations bursting with expressive & energetic animals that children just wont be able to resist wanting to copy as they leap splash & roll over the pages! So its a book for more than reading: its a book for climbing aboard singing along to & joining in with.. .all.. .day.. .long!
